Z-Axis Meandering Patch Antenna and Fabrication Thereof

Abstract

Apparatus and techniques described herein can include antenna configurations and related fabrication. For example, a Z-axis meandering antenna configuration can be fabri­cated, such as by forming a dielectric substrate extending in two dimensions and defining an undulating region extending out of a plane defined by the two dimensions; and forming at least one conductive region following a contour of the dielectric substrate including at least a portion of the undu­lating region. The at least one conductive region can follow the contour of the dielectric substrate, such as including a first conductive region on a first layer, and a second con­ductive region on another layer separate from the first conductive region of the first conductive layer
